What you’ll need
To create this delicious Rustic Fruit Pie, gather these essential ingredients:
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 cup unsalted butter, chilled and diced
- 1/4 cup sugar (for the crust)
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 6 to 8 tablespoons ice water
- 4 cups mixed fruits (apples, berries, or peaches)
- 1/2 cup sugar (for filling)
- 1 tablespoon lemon juice
- 1 tablespoon cornstarch
- 1 teaspoon cinnamon
You can easily substitute different fruits based on your preferences, or even use frozen fruits if fresh ones aren’t available.
